About Natural Bridge, Alabama

Natural Bridge, Alabama, unfolds as a verdant expanse where the rolling hills of the Appalachian foothills soften into a gentle, wooded landscape. It lies 49.0 miles south of Florence, AL (from Florence, AL: bearing 175°T), and is situated 9.3 miles south of Haleyville. This corner of Winston County draws its name and its primary allure from a remarkable geological formation: a natural stone arch spanning a deep ravine, a testament to the patient artistry of water and time. While the bridge itself is a singular wonder, the history of Natural Bridge is less about grand pronouncements and more about the quiet persistence of its people. For generations, the economy here has been tied to the land, with small farms dotting the landscape and timber providing a steady, if sometimes challenging, livelihood. The surrounding forests, rich with diverse flora and fauna, have always been a source of sustenance and a place of quiet contemplation. Today, tourism centered around the natural bridge offers a glimpse into a simpler way of life, inviting visitors to wander the trails and experience the enduring, unhurried charm of Natural Bridge.
